I have a 2005 Road King and I have researched this leaky check valve problem quite extensively, as it happened to me a couple years ago. Back then I too was appalled at the prices so sought out a more reasonable solution. I ended up doing the same thing, and bought those same Fuel tool o rings to very carefully replace the lower o ring (there is an upper one in there, too). Good luck trying to rebuild the whole thing without the Fuel Tool tool, which costs $100! Anyway, here I am 2 years on and it is leaking again. Not regularly, and not much. It is very slight. But it is leaking and it will no doubt just get worse with time. I have a big trip coming up so I am fixing this once and for all. Turns out you can replace the whole check valve AND the inside the tank pex fuel hose connected to it for only about $30, including shipping. Its a Drag specialties part on Revzilla. In my research I have learned that the 2 pex lines inside the tank, as well as the Fuel pressure regulator housing, can get brittle (ethanol fuel effects on plastics and rubber) and fail and cause lots of problems and even leave you hopelessly stranded. So that's it. Im taking the whole unit out and I am replacing everything inside the tank (except the fuel pump) up to and including the leaky check valve. SO, two hoses, the regulator, housing, check valve and fuel filter. Also replacing the gasket and special screws that seal and hold the top plate down. I Already bought the parts. If you have an older fuel injected Harley and havent thought about whats inside that tank you may wanna get in there and replace that stuff as preventative maintenance.

I'll try the small o-ring first but I removed the check valve from the tank but it looks good . Blew in the check valve hose and it holds air then I pushed in on the valve and air escaped so it seems good . My Road King has two check valves at the bottom of the tank . One is high pressure ( check valve near outside of tank ) and one a return. The return hose is smaller than the pressure hose. If you buy the short hose it won't work for the pressure ( to short) so knowing that will save you money. The pressure hose with check valve is 22" long, return is shorter.
